IP Check: 85.115.208.61
Country: Kyrgyzstan
We found 3 matches for IP Addresses '85.115.208.61'
Most Recent Activity:
July 21, 2024: mckenzie-betancourt@2022darkmarkets.comJuly 01, 2024: karissa-kruse@asapmarketonion.com
May 29, 2024: tania.sawyer5@1cryptodarkmarket.com
 


